Abstract
Ashes and slags of thermal power stations are the materials which last high-temperature processing and have received specific properties, predetermining an opportunity of their effective- utilization in manufacture of various building materials that proves to be true by scientific researches and practical experience. The high chemical activity of ashes and slags of thermal power stations in comparison with the materials, that not last thermal processings, allows more than on third to lower fuel and energy expenses at their subsequent use in manufacture of building materials and products.
